Giovanni Mpetshi Perricard and Luca Nardi will square off in the 2nd round of the Shanghai Rolex Masters for the 1st time in their career. They are scheduled to compete on Friday at 5:30 pm on COURT 4. Here the head to head stats and relative prediction.

Ranked no. 37, Mpetshi Perricard will start his run in Shanghai after he played his last match in Beijing where he lost 7-6(3) 6-7(4) 6-4 to Musetti in the 1st round on the 26th of September.
Giovanni has an overall 18-21 win-loss record in 2025, 10-12 on hard (See FULL STATS).
His best result of the season was winning the title the Bordeaux Challenger where he defeated Nikoloz Basilashvili in the final 6-3 6-7(5) 7-5.
Talking about his overall career, The French player has an overall 164-131 record. He has a positive 51-39 record on hard.

Ranked no. 88, Luca got to the 2nd round after beating Sebastian Ofner 3-6 6-3 6-2.
In the 1st round against Ofner, The Italian recovered from a 1-set down deficit before winning (3-6 6-3 6-2). During the match Nardi scored 82 points vs Ofner’s 77. The Italian was quite aggressive to blast 38 winners.
Talking about serving, Nardi bagged 5 aces and he committed only 5 double faults. Overall, Luca Nardi was very efficient on serve to win 78% (38/49) of his 1st serve and 56% (18/32) on the second serve. However, this didn’t prevent his to concede the serve once. Nardi broke Ofner 3 times after converting 33% of his break points (3/9).
Nardi’s best result of the current season was getting to the final in the Koblenz Challenger.
The Italian has a compiled 28-26 win-loss record in 2025, 14-12 on hard (See FULL STATS).
